Anke van der Kooij was born in Delft, Holland, on the 7th of
September 1980. She studied singing at the Royal Conservatory
in The Hague, where she got her degree in May 2005. She studied
there with Sasja Hunnego and Gerda van Zelm. Now she studies
with Liesbeth Damen.
She sang in many projects, in the oratorio and opera
repertoire. Amongst others she sang the roles of Adalgisa in
Norma (Bellini) and Dido in Dido and Aeneas (Purcell) In the
oratorio repertoire she recently sang the soprano solos in
Fauré's Requiem, Jansen's Requiem (with the composer, CD
recording in February 2006), and Blackford's Mirror of
Perfection. She sang all of the Wesendonck Lieder with
orchestra, and sang in many opera recitals amongst others
aria's of Mimi (La Bohème), Desdemona (Othello), Rosina (Il
barbiere di Siviglia), Marguerite (Faust - Gounod), Michaela
(Carmen), Marzelline (Beethoven) etc. On the 5th of July
latest, she sang in the well known radioprogramme of Opera
Pietje in a theatre in Zaandam.
She finds it very important to share her experience in
singing with others, so she teaches singing lessons and
courses, and she is the conductor of youth choir 'Rejoice'
